INTRODUCTION
Organisational study is done in order for the purpose of acquiring practical knowledge of working and functioning of the company. It shows the different departments in an organisation. V guard industries is a company which has created a niche for itself and has been nurtured by quality consciousness, passion for hardwork and will to succeed. The organisational study was undertaken mainly to study the departmental functions of V-Guard Industries ltd. Established in the year 1977, from the vision of one man, Kochouseph Chittilappilly.
